Understanding Your Brake Light Switch and Why It Matters

Your brake light switch is a small but important component of your vehicle's braking system. Located behind your brake pedal, this switch detects when you press the brake pedal and sends a signal to turn on your brake lights. When the switch works properly, your brake lights illuminate immediately, alerting drivers behind you that you are slowing down or stopping. This split-second warning can prevent rear-end collisions and keep you and your passengers safer on the road.

The National Highway Traffic Safety Administration (NHTSA) reports that rear-end collisions account for approximately 29% of all police-reported crashes in the United States. Many of these accidents could be prevented with properly functioning brake lights. A faulty brake light switch means your brake lights may not turn on when you press the pedal, leaving drivers behind you unaware that you are braking. This creates a serious safety hazard for everyone on the road.

Brake light switches typically last between 150,000 and 200,000 miles, though this varies depending on your vehicle and driving habits. Some switches fail earlier due to moisture intrusion, electrical corrosion, or mechanical wear. Unlike many car parts, a brake light switch is relatively inexpensive to replace, usually costing between $75 and $200 for parts and labor at a repair shop, though the actual part itself typically costs only $10 to $50.

Common Signs Your Brake Light Switch Is Failing

Several warning signs indicate your brake light switch may need replacement. The most obvious is when your brake lights do not turn on when you press the brake pedal. Have someone stand behind your vehicle while you press the brake pedal and observe whether the lights illuminate. If they do not, a faulty switch is often the cause. However, the problem could also stem from blown bulbs, a blown fuse, or wiring issues, so check these components first before replacing the switch.

Another common sign is brake lights that turn on and off sporadically or remain on constantly even when the brake pedal is not pressed. This intermittent behavior typically results from a switch contact that is corroded or worn. The electrical connection inside the switch may work sometimes and fail other times, creating an unreliable signal. You might notice this pattern develops gradually, with the lights flickering occasionally before the problem worsens.

Some drivers notice their cruise control does not work properly, even though the system seemed fine previously. Many vehicles use the brake light switch as a safety feature to deactivate cruise control when you press the brake pedal. If the switch is failing, cruise control may not disengage when it should, creating a safety concern. This connection between the brake light switch and cruise control is less obvious than direct brake light problems but equally important.

A stuck or unresponsive brake pedal can also signal switch issues. If the switch is mechanically jammed or the internal components are seized, the pedal may feel different when pressed. However, this symptom is less common than electrical failures. Most brake light switch problems are purely electrical, with the mechanical components remaining functional.

Tools and Materials You Will Need

Before starting a brake light switch replacement, gather all necessary tools and materials. Having everything ready before you begin prevents frustration and ensures a smooth process. Most of the items needed are basic tools found in many households or available inexpensively at hardware stores or auto parts retailers.

The following tools are essential: a socket set or wrench set (typically 8mm to 13mm sockets work for most vehicles), a screwdriver set with both Phillips and flathead options, a multimeter for testing electrical connections, and a flashlight or work light to see clearly under the dashboard. You will also need jack stands or ramps to safely lift your vehicle if you need to access the switch from underneath, though most modern vehicles allow access from inside the cabin near the brake pedal.

For materials, you will need a replacement brake light switch specific to your vehicle's year, make, and model. Do not purchase a generic switch; always match the part number to your exact vehicle. You can find the correct part number in your vehicle's owner manual or by contacting your local auto parts store with your vehicle information. The switch itself typically costs between $10 and $50, depending on your vehicle type.

Additional materials include electrical contact cleaner to remove corrosion from electrical connections, dielectric grease to protect electrical connectors from moisture, and possibly a brake light assembly removal tool if your vehicle requires it. Some vehicles may require a specific tool to disconnect the electrical connector, so check your vehicle manual before purchasing tools.

Safety equipment is also important. Wear safety glasses to protect your eyes from debris or dust in the engine bay, and use gloves to keep your hands clean. If you are working under the vehicle, always use proper support like jack stands rated for your vehicle's weight. Never rely solely on a jack to keep your vehicle elevated while you work underneath it.

Step-by-Step Replacement Instructions

Replacing a brake light switch is a manageable task for someone with basic mechanical knowledge. The process varies slightly depending on your vehicle, but the general steps remain similar. Always consult your vehicle's service manual for specific instructions and diagrams related to your make and model.

First, disconnect the negative terminal of your vehicle's battery. This prevents electrical shocks and protects your vehicle's electrical system while you work. Locate the negative battery terminal (marked with a minus sign or black cable) and loosen the nut holding it in place using the appropriate wrench size. Once loose, slide the terminal off the battery post. Wait a few minutes before proceeding to allow residual electrical charge to dissipate.

Next, locate the brake light switch under the dashboard near the brake pedal. In most vehicles, you can access it from inside the cabin without lifting the vehicle. Look for a cylindrical or rectangular component attached to a bracket near the top of the brake pedal. You will see an electrical connector attached to the switch. Gently pull this connector away from the switch. If it is stuck, wiggle it slightly while pulling. Take a photo with your phone before disconnecting the wires so you can remember which connector goes where.

Once the electrical connector is disconnected, locate the mounting bolts or clips holding the switch in place. Most switches are secured with one or two bolts. Using the appropriate socket or wrench, remove these bolts. The switch should now slide out from its mounting bracket. Some switches rotate to disengage from the bracket, so check which method applies to your vehicle.

Before installing the new switch, examine the mounting bracket for any debris or corrosion. Clean it if necessary using a dry cloth or contact cleaner. Position the new brake light switch in the same location and orientation as the old one. Secure it with the bolts you removed earlier, tightening them firmly but not excessively. Hand-tight is usually sufficient; over-tightening can crack the plastic switch housing.
